Experience

May 2003 to Current

US Air Force

Weather Forecaster

Uses satellite and radar imagery, computer generated graphics, and weather communication equipment and instruments to analyze atmospheric and space data and information.

Forecasts atmospheric and space weather conditions. Issues warnings and advisories to alert users to mission critical weather. Exploits weather analysis and data to enhance combat operations and training.

Tailors and communicates weather information to meet operational requirements.

Manages weather operations. Adapts weather resources to meet mission requirements. Ensures standardization and quality weather products, operations, and activities.
